Key Insights
The global tungsten carbide powder market is projected for substantial growth, estimated at 9.84 billion by 2025, with a compound annual growth rate (CAGR) of 12.77% from 2025 to 2033. This expansion is driven by rising demand for advanced materials in critical sectors including machine tools, ammunition, and high-wear aerospace & defense components. Growth is further propelled by the robust performance of the mining, construction, oil, and gas industries, all requiring durable, high-strength tungsten carbide powders. Technological innovations enhancing powder production and material properties are also key drivers. The increasing adoption of tungsten carbide powder in specialized healthcare and electronics applications further fuels market expansion. However, market growth may be constrained by tungsten price volatility and environmental considerations associated with its extraction and processing. The market is segmented by application (machine tools, ammunition, wear & die parts, others) and end-user industry (mining & construction, aerospace & defense, transportation, oil & gas, healthcare, others). Leading players, including Kennametal Inc. and Merck KGaA, are actively investing in R&D to innovate and expand their market reach. The Asia-Pacific region, particularly China, is anticipated to lead market share due to its significant manufacturing capabilities and strong demand across diverse end-use sectors.

Tungsten Carbide Powder Industry Product Landscape
The tungsten carbide powder market offers a wide range of grades, each carefully engineered for specific applications. Product innovation is relentlessly focused on achieving finer particle sizes, higher purity levels, and improved sinterability to optimize the performance of the resulting cemented carbide components. Key performance metrics, including particle size distribution, precise chemical composition, and consistent flowability, are critical for end-user satisfaction. Unique selling propositions frequently emphasize superior quality, consistent performance, and customized solutions tailored to individual application requirements. Recent technological breakthroughs include the development of nano-sized tungsten carbide powders, which deliver enhanced properties for highly specialized applications, further expanding the capabilities of this versatile material.
